Infusion Coordinator

Articularis Heathcare Group
07.2024 - Current
  • I worked as an Infusion Coordinator, both level I and II. I primary worked with NextGen, Eblu, some We Inufuse, and Epic. I streamlined communication between healthcare providers and patients, ensuring timely delivery of infusion therapy. On a daily basis I would review the schedule, call patients to inform them of their estimations, signed patients up for Copay Assistance Programs, obtained Prior Authorizations for patients, renewed expiring authorizations and much more. I have been the primary infusion coordinator up to 3 offices at a time. The skills I have gained from this job are prioritization of tasks, working independently, efficiency, and communication.
